## Escalation

If the ChronoGate chip reader at the Larkfield Marathon finish line drops more than 5% of reads, restart the antenna array via the Pacerline console. If reads remain degraded after two restarts, escalate to the Timing Ops rotation — do not attempt firmware flashes on race day. For escalations outside race hours, reach the ChronoGate maintainers at the address below.

escalation mailbox, bafog-fafog: ulador@paliqlabs.internal

MEMO — To all sales leads, from Commercial Ops at Breglio Foods

Quick heads-up: we're overhauling the Pantry Points loyalty programme. Points will now accrue on volume, not invoice value, and top-tier members get quarterly perks instead of annual. Yes, some regulars will grumble — talk them through it, don't just forward the FAQ. Full rollout lands next quarter. The thinking behind the change is summarised in the note below.

confidential, kagup-bafog: Fraaxax Group is in early talks to buy Soroxox Group for about $343.8 million. The Olidor launch date is June 14, and nothing goes to the press before then. Legal wants the Aldmirek Logistics term sheet signed before July 23.

## Formula sandbox tuning

User-supplied formulas in Gridmoor execute inside a restricted interpreter with hard ceilings on time, memory, and call depth. Reviewers should confirm any change to these ceilings is justified in the PR description, since raising them widens the abuse surface. Defaults were chosen from production traces. The current limits are as follows.

limits module of tafog-fawip:
WEIGHTS = {
    "julix": 57,
    "lamys": 992,
    "kasvan": 209,
    "quenok": 750,
    "alddor": 259,
    "oliath": 1009,
    "wenix": 815,
}

Finance Review — Legacy Pricing, Vellamar Software

Quick recap for the team: we're moving legacy Tidebook customers to the new rate card in Q3, roughly an 8% bump. Churn modeling by Priya's group suggests minimal fallout if we grandfather annual plans one more cycle. Margins should recover nicely by year end. One item stays need-to-know below.

internal memo for kawip-hadug: Headcount on the Wenwyn team goes from 7 to 140 by the end of January. Gross margin on Wenwyn came in at 20 percent against a plan of 15 percent.